**Q: How do Pennywhistle webhooks retry?** Good question — it trips everyone up at first. We retry failed deliveries with exponential backoff: 1 min, 5 min, 30 min, then hourly for 24 hours. Anything returning 2xx stops retries; a 410 permanently disables the endpoint. Duplicates are possible, so make handlers idempotent. The full retry policy, including timeout values and signature verification steps, is documented here.

operations page: https://vault.qorvelcorp.example/settings

Subject: Pagination change shipping tonight

Hey release folks — the Wrenport public API now uses cursor-based pagination everywhere; offset params still work but log a deprecation warning. Future maintainers: the cursor is opaque on purpose, so please don't let anyone parse it client-side. Docs are updated, and the SDK examples follow in tomorrow's push. If anything looks off in staging, roll back to the previous tag. The build going out is identified by the token below.

trace token, fafog-kageg: htk4_98e6

Plugin authors: the Switchloom rollout framework loads third-party flag evaluators at startup. Build against the v3 SDK only; v2 hooks are removed. Declare your rollout strategy in plugin.yaml and keep evaluation under 5ms — slow evaluators get disabled automatically. Test against the Driftgate sandbox before submitting. All submitted plugins must be signed; unsigned bundles are rejected at load time. Publish through the Switchloom partner channel and wait for the compatibility scan to finish. Sign your bundle with the key that follows.

rollout seal: bky4_x7Gc

Subject: Broker upgrade next week — quick heads-up

Hi, and welcome to the rotation! Next Tuesday we're upgrading the Pigeonpost broker from 3.9 to 4.1 across the Larkfield cluster. Nothing dramatic, but consumers on the old wire protocol will reconnect a few times, so expect some noisy-but-harmless alerts between 02:00 and 03:00. If anything actually breaks, roll back the coordinator node first — it's the only stateful piece. The full upgrade plan, rollback steps, and the go/no-go checklist are all on this page:

operations page: https://jenkins.zemvarcloud.local/job/merge_requests/repo/build/73930b4b30f0a8ed